Transaction 51a1186b569b4d30a0133c6933695a0d84d7bfadae944f6da6c13118b3e49cfd
1 Input
1 Output
-
51a1186b569b4d30a0133c6933695a0d84d7bfadae944f6da6c13118b3e49cfd:0
- value
- 33593
- script pubkey
- OP_0 OP_PUSHBYTES_20 68a4f992bb57e37f1ab00190317f04505ede6e82
- address
- bc1qdzj0ny4m2l3h7x4sqxgrzlcy2p0dum5zrvxap0